Scope

This standard specifies the inductively coupled plasma mass spectrometry method for the determination of 65 elements in water. This standard applies to silver, aluminum, arsenic, gold, boron, barium, beryllium, bismuth, calcium, cadmium, cerium, cobalt, chromium, cesium, copper, dysprosium, erbium, Europium, iron, gallium, gadolinium, germanium, hafnium, holmium, indium, iridium, potassium, lanthanum, lithium, lutetium, magnesium, manganese, molybdenum, sodium, niobium, neodymium, nickel, phosphorus, lead, palladium, praseodymium, platinum, Determination of rubidium, rhenium, rhodium, ruthenium, antimony, scandium, selenium, samarium, tin, strontium, terbium, tellurium, thorium, titanium, thallium, thulium, uranium, vanadium, tungsten, yttrium, ytterbium, zinc, zirconium. The detection limit of each element in this method is 0.02~19.6 μg/L, and the lower limit of determination is 0.08~78.4 μg/L. Please see Appendix A for the method detection limits of each element.
